In Jamaica, regulatory measures are the formal rules and standards established by government authorities to oversee and control various sectors, including real estate. These regulations have been crucial in shaping the country’s development landscape, ensuring that construction, land use, and property transactions align with legal and environmental standards. The evolution of regulatory frameworks in Jamaica reflects a journey from colonial regulations to more modern and comprehensive guidelines. Initially, regulations were designed to manage basic land use and property transactions. Over time, as Jamaica’s economy and urban areas grew, the need for more detailed and stringent regulations became apparent. Today, these regulations cover a wide range of issues, from zoning and building codes to property tax assessments and environmental protections.
